To help settle some pre-race anxiety I went through my three favorite (and easy to follow) tips. Funny that these are the same three tips I followed before my first 5K. Boy have I come a long way..
1. Prepare- It’s VITAL to take care of yourself before a race. It’s not necessarily what you do the day of the race, but rather how you prepare BEFORE the race. Regardless of the distance of the race, make sure to stick to the routine. Don’t try and get fancy, just eat what you normally would before a run, stretch like you always have, and HYDRATE. Have everything laid out the night before so there are no last-minute search and rescue missions!
2. Breathe- When I get nervous my breathing becomes shallow. This only makes things worse, especially when you’re trying to watch your heart rate. Take slow, deep breaths. I call these.. Yoga breaths. Relaxing, huh?
3. Smile- The hard part is over!!!!! It always makes me feel better to smile, high-five, and wave at people during the race. It reminds me that racing is fun and I love running so why stress about the results? And, ALWAYS smile at the cameras and at the finish line because eventually those pictures will be on the Internet. 🙂
